Enblem of Wekusta 2
To complete the research we would like to know if anybody has a drawing/sketch or foto of the insignia/emblem of the Wekusta 2 stationed in Nantes/France.
According some sources it could be a weathercock on top of a globe. Any help appreciated. |

Re: Enblem of Wekusta 2
There is a color illustration of this emblem on page 61 of Luftwaffe Emblems 1939-1945 by Barry Ketley & Mark Rolfe. It is a weathercock on top of a globe.

Re: Enblem of Wekusta 2
Yes, that is indeed the insignia of Wekusta 2. Ob.d.L. The excellent book "Wekusta - Luftwaffe Meteorological Reconnaissance Units and Operations 1938 - 1945" by John A. Kington and Franz Selinger shows this insignia in colour on page 56 in the section which is a mini-history of this unit. The vane is in yellow while the globe is blue with black continents.
